What's Happening?
The Graduate Career Consortium has introduced a new Individual Development Plan (IDP) tool specifically designed for career development professionals in higher education. This tool aims to address the
unique challenges faced by these professionals, such as navigating unclear career paths and balancing evolving skill demands. The IDP tool is structured to help users assess their skills, set career goals, and develop action plans, while also fostering mentorship opportunities. It is tailored to the realities of academic administration, providing resources and prompts that reflect the specific needs of the field.
